I'm looking for a backup software that'll sync certain folders in my internal and external HDs. any ideas?


I always growing music library (100gb and robust). I bought an external hard drive to back it up and use while traveling. I am looking for a simple software that will make sure my \ folder of music is synchronized with the external drive, so that I could just as easily listen to music from the outside when connecting to another PC.

It is important to keep the \ music \ Artist \ album of structure in tact as I am very methodical about the artwork and good mp3 marking of music.

All ideas for a program that will do when I connect the external HD? Preferably not automatic, I will gladly start the application once a week or so, the USB connection and synchronization. Similar to the way in which works with Palm prospects etc.

freeware would be best, but I do not mind paying as well, if necessary. I got rid of all my records and the collection is now some GS ...

You can use Acronis True Image Home for this. It can backup your music library in the book you have been set. True Image is a scheduler that do a backup as often as you wish, and it will make a differential backup in capturing only changes since the last backup.
